Lets say we have a map called "Email Services" and another map "File
Services" on these maps are the individual service probes for their
components, along with the devices/servers.

We have several services that may share the same server.

So email and file_services also share server_A, and we need to take
server_A down for maintenance.  If we has a probe for server_A on both
maps, we would have to pre-acknowledge it on both maps.

By object linking, I am asking if we acknowledge server_A on the email
map, that it would also be acknowledged on the file_services map?  At
least that is the way we would like it to work.

I am assuming that these "object links" would be uni-directional? That is, if you acknowledge server_A, then email_service_A and file_service_A would be acknowledged as well, but if you acknowledge email_service_A, this does not affect server_A or file_service_A.

To put it another way, the relationship is equivalent to parent/child?

server_A is the parent. It has two children: email_service_A and file_service_A.
